As some of you already know, my first novel, THE FLOCK, got the
interest of a major movie producer last year. That producer, Don
Murphy (NATURAL BORN KILLERS, APT PUPIL, LEAGUE OF EXTRAORDINARY
GENTLEMEN, FROM HELL, SHOOT 'EM UP, etc.) partnered with John Wells
(WEST WING, ER, etc.) and Warner Brothers to make my book into a
feature film.

My literary/film agent just called to let me know that we have
received my first cash advance and that it appears the project has
been (in Hollywood parlance) "green lighted".

We'll see. I'll keep you guys posted on any further developments.
